Outdoor Survival Skills: Your Water Bottle as a Multi-Functional Tool in Wilderness Survival

In wilderness survival, water is the primary condition for sustaining life. However, a well-designed water bottle serves functions far beyond just holding water. In emergencies, it can become a multi-functional survival tool, helping you acquire, purify, and even store precious water vital for survival. Besides carrying drinking water, an empty water bottle can also be used as a container to collect dew or rainwater when rainfall is scarce; and in situations where water is available but of unknown quality, knowing how to use the water bottle for simple purification becomes exceptionally crucial.

thermos water bottle made of food-grade stainless steel showcases its versatility to the extreme in the wilderness. It not only maintains the temperature of drinking water for extended periods (whether hot or cold) but can also, in the absence of other tools, serve as a vessel for boiling impure water (after removing any external coatings). In high-altitude or cold environments, a cup of warm water can effectively combat hypothermia. Some specialized thermos water bottles with mirror-like finishes can even be used to reflect sunlight as an auxiliary tool for signaling for help. By considering your water bottle a core multi-functional tool in your wilderness survival gear, it is not merely a satisfier of physiological needs but a wise choice that enhances your chances of survival and ensures life safety when battling the forces of nature.
